appreciation n 1 :
understanding of the nature or meaning or quality or magnitude of something ; "
he has a good grasp of accounting practices " [
synonym : {
appreciation }, {
grasp }, {
hold }]
2 :
delicate discrimination (
especially of aesthetic values );
"
arrogance and lack of taste contributed to his rapid success "; "
to ask at that particular time was the ultimate in bad taste " [
synonym : {
taste }, {
appreciation }, {
discernment },
{
perceptiveness }]
3 :
an expression of gratitude ; "
he expressed his appreciation in a short note "
4 :
a favorable judgment ; "
a small token in admiration of your works " [
synonym : {
admiration }, {
appreciation }]
5 :
an increase in price or value ; "
an appreciation of 30 %
in the value of real estate " [
ant : {
depreciation }]
Appreciation \
Ap *
pre `
ci *
a "
tion \,
n . [
Cf .
F .
appr ['
e ]
ciation .]
1 .
A just valuation or estimate of merit ,
worth ,
weight ,
etc .;
recognition of excellence .
[
1913 Webster ]
2 .
Accurate perception ;
true estimation ;
as ,
an appreciation of the difficulties before us ;
an appreciation of colors .
[
1913 Webster ]
His foreboding showed his appreciation of Henry '
s character . --
J .
R .
Green .
[
1913 Webster ]
3 .
A rise in value ; --
opposed to {
depreciation }.
[
1913 Webster ]
